"Contacts with their objects, O son of Kunti, give rise to cold and heat, pleasure and pain. They come and go and are impermanent. Endure them bravely."
Modern explanation
Begin today by remembering: Feelings are weather, not climate. The strongest storm still ends.
Practical application
Before opening any message or task, take three slow breaths and name one thing that is already steady in you.
Reflection question
What am I gripping that I could loosen for the next hour?
